Yushchenko rejects PM post if he fails the eletion

Ukrainian President Viktor Yushchenko said he will not accept the post of the country's prime minister in case his main political opponent Viktor Yanukovych wins the presidential election. Yushhenko said at the TV talk show "Freedom of Speech."

“I have never been and will never be involved in the intrigues of political forces that do against Ukraine,” he said. Besides Viktor Yushchenko also noted that he would not be the premier, because he will be the president.
